General Info
In Block
14f5fcd391418ef6678960a2e5a9a87c14443f97f26d934f2753b17ee87bcfe3
In block height
Total Input
2753706.61527752 RDD
Total Output
2754578.84637351 RDD
Transaction Details
Fee
0 RDD
mined Sun, 09 Dec 2018 20:51:56 UTC
From
2753706.61527752 RDD